How does a night vision monocular achieve precise observation in dark environments?

Publish Time: 2026-03-11
As a crucial tool in modern optical equipment, the night vision monocular, leveraging digital night vision technology, offers unprecedented convenience and precision for observation in dark environments. It can amplify weak light or use infrared imaging to clearly reveal objects invisible to the human eye, enabling effective observation even at night. Whether for outdoor exploration, night hunting, security monitoring, or wildlife observation, the digital night vision monocular demonstrates efficient, accurate, and reliable observation capabilities.

Digital night vision technology is the core advantage of this monocular. Through photoelectric detection and digital signal processing, the telescope can capture weak light in low-light or no-light environments and convert it into a clear image displayed on a screen. Users can observe distant targets using digital magnification without relying on external lighting. Digital night vision goggles not only enhance visibility but also enable image storage, recording, and sharing, meeting the needs of various applications such as scientific research, patrolling, and entertainment. The combination of high-resolution sensors and optimized optical lenses ensures that the night vision monocular maintains stable clarity and color reproduction during nighttime observation, enhancing the user experience.
